Metro
The Barcelona Metro operates as a subway system which links different neighborhoods of the city. Public transportation emerges as the quickest method of traveling since it serves as the preferred choice for visitors to explore the city. From Monday to Thursday and on Sundays the metro serves passengers between 5:00 am and midnight. The transportation service runs without interruption between Fridays and public holiday evenings.

T-10 Card
The T-10 card grants users up to ten possible one-way journeys on all Barcelona public transport. The T-10 card serves travelers who need occasional citywide transportation including groups who share the card.
